Mahaveer Raghunathan
Mahaveer Raghunathan (born November 17, 1998 in Chennai ) is an Indian automobile racing driver . In 2019 Raghunathan started in the FIA Formula 2 Championship .
Career
Raghunathan began his motorsport career in karting in 2011 , where he remained active until 2013. In 2012 Raghunathan made his debut in formula racing and made four guest starts in the JK Racing Asia Series . In 2013 he drove in the MRF Challenge Formula 1600 and achieved sixth place overall. He also took part in three races of the Chinese Formula Masters . In 2014 Raghunathan moved to Europe and competed for F & M in the Italian Formula 4 championship . A fourth place in the championship standings was his best result. He finished the season in twelfth place overall, while his teammate Mattia Drudi finished second overall.
At the beginning of 2015, Raghunathan took part in a race of the MRF Challenge Formula 2000 in India . He then returned to Europe and was given a cockpit at Motopark Academy for the 2015 European Formula 3 Championship . He didn't appear at the last event and a 20th place was his best result. He also made two guest starts each in the Alpine Formula Renault and the Euroformula Open .
In the 2016 season, Raghunathan drove in the Auto GP for the Italian team PS Racing , led by Coloni . Besides Luis Michael Dörrbecker , he was the only driver who competed in every race. Raghunathan was second behind Dörrbecker with 151 to 222 points. As the races were partly held together with the Boss GP , Raghunathan was also rated here. With two podium finishes, he finished fifth in the formula class. In addition, Raghunathan took part in an event of the GP3 series for Koiranen GP .
In 2019 Raghunathan competed in the FIA Formula 2 Championship for MP Motorsport . He finished the season with just one point in 20th place. During the season he collected so many penalty points that despite being excluded from the race weekend in Spielberg, he achieved enough penalty points to be excluded a second time. The Mexican Patricio O'Ward took over his starting place in Austria , Raghunathan did not have to take the second penalty, as it was pronounced after the last training in Abu Dhabi . The regulations for the 2019 season provided for exclusion from racing for the following weekend, and penalty points are only valid for one season. As a result, the regulations for the 2020 season were changed so that racing exclusions are now also possible within a weekend. In addition, FIA President Jean Todt considered introducing a minimum number of super license points for the junior formula categories after Raghunathan's season . This is to prevent unqualified drivers from occupying cockpits.
A scene during training in Baku also attracted particular attention when Raghunathan failed to turn in the run-off zone without the help of the marshals.
